Are there any banks in Ponemah that specialize in serving the financial needs of the local Native American community?
Yes, Ponemah is home to a branch of the Native American Bank, which is a unique financial institution dedicated to promoting economic development in Native American communities. They offer standard banking services like checking and savings accounts, but with a specific understanding of the financial landscape and needs of tribal members, including programs for homeownership on trust land and small business loans tailored to local entrepreneurs.
What options do I have for accessing cash or making deposits if I live in the more remote parts of the Ponemah area?
Given Ponemah's location on the Red Lake Indian Reservation, physical bank branches can be limited. Your best options are the local Bremer Bank branch or Northern Eagle Credit Union for in-person services. For everyday cash access, the ATMs at these institutions and local businesses are key. Northern Eagle Credit Union is also part of a shared branching network, allowing you to use other credit union locations for basic transactions. Additionally, all three major local banks offer robust mobile banking apps for remote check deposits and account management.

What should I consider when choosing between a national bank like Bremer and a local institution like Native American Bank or Northern Eagle Credit Union in Ponemah?
Your choice depends on your priorities. Bremer Bank, while headquartered in Minnesota, offers a wider network of ATMs and branches across the region, which is beneficial if you travel frequently. In contrast, Native American Bank offers a deeply specialized understanding of tribal economics and may provide unique lending products. Northern Eagle Credit Union, as a not-for-profit, often provides lower fees and higher savings rates, with a strong focus on local community development. For day-to-day banking with a community feel, the credit union or Native American Bank are excellent; for a broader regional footprint, Bremer may be preferable.
